Verb[edit]

shitify (third-person singular simple present shitifies, present participle shitifying, simple past and past participle shitified)

  1. Alternative form of shittify
    • 2001 January 13, Chris Hedley, “Tipping in bars/restaurants?”, in soc.culture.irish[1] (Usenet):
      Another pub in the middle of town, a bit crummy but with a decent enough atmosphere and an interesting history, also caused a big fuss a few years ago when a chain of Plastic Oirish Pubs'R'Us that no Irishman would be seen dead in took the place over and shitified it.
